    Octa coil questions

    If you are referring to this photo... Take a standard Poseidon with 4 parallel coils... and double it. With this, you have two coils per negative post, one on each side, which makes two coils in series... times four negative posts, in parallel. Or... 4X series by 4X parallel. It...

  13. State O' Flux

    Derringer coil is killing my kogendo!

    That would be around a 1.4mm ID to get 14 wraps from 28 gauge for 0.8Ω... pretty small, but not unusual. Your Ohm's law heat flux is a pretty cool 120 mW/mm² +/-... so it's definitely not too hot. You might try going up on the ID (which will allow a larger wick/juice surface area in the...

  17. State O' Flux

    Kayfun V4 - no Vapor problem!

    Sounds like a 510 conductivity issue... that being, you don't have any. ;-) Innokin is notorious for sinking their 510 positive pins too deeply into the female negative collet. You can try a few things... several actually, in varying degrees of difficulty and permanence. Look at the Kayfun...
